    Water heals...

    I've been playing a shaman for a main off and on since the early days of vanilla. I always found it odd that shaman shared druid healing graphical effects. Priests had a healing effect style while pallies enjoyed a slightly different style of holy healing effects. Back in vanilla and BC I used to talk about how shaman should have a "puff" version of nature heals compared to druid heals similar to how pally and priest effects compare. Blizz has of course, done one better in recent times...

    I have really enjoyed the slow shift of shaman healing away from nature heals, toward water healing. With the not so recent addition of riptide, a useful healing stream totem, and the recent addition of the water effect for greater healing wave, I think shaman heals have made a strong bid for unique style. It seems really unique and stylized.

    Anyone else really hoping for water effects for the remaining healing wave and healing surge spells? For some reason, although it has no real impact on gameplay, I am really looking forward to seeing more water balloon splashes on my heal targets ^.^
